A feasibility study in project management serves as a critical tool for evaluating the project's viability. This involves a comprehensive assessment that addresses whether the proposed project can be successfully undertaken based on various factors, including technical, economic, legal, operational, and scheduling considerations. By conducting a feasibility study, project managers can identify potential challenges and opportunities, thereby informing decision-makers whether to proceed with the project or explore alternatives.

This process allows for the gathering of necessary data and insights to ensure that all aspects of the project are considered, ultimately guiding strategic planning and resource allocation.
